The Standing Committee on Primary Industries will inquire into and report on factors shaping social licence and economic development outcomes in critical minerals projects across Australia. The inquiry will consider:
- The effectiveness of engagement practices with local communities, Traditional Owners, and other stakeholders.
- How critical minerals projects contribute strategically to regional and national economic development.
- Opportunities to strengthen workforce participation, skills development, and employment pathways, particularly in remote and Indigenous communities.
- The role of state, territory, and local governments in supporting socially and economically sustainable development.
- Options for improved coordination between jurisdictions and the Commonwealth.
